is bakeing soda and bicarbonate of soda the same thing

6 replies

redzebra10 · 11/11/2018 10:03

i know i sound daft but i can't find bakeing soda on the shop only bicarb
it's to clean the carpet not for cooking

OP posts:
SpuriouserAndSpuriouser · 11/11/2018 10:04

Yes, baking soda is the American name, in the UK it’s bicarbonate of soda.

CatulusLady78 · 11/11/2018 10:05

Yes it's the same. Baking soda is just bicarb. Baking powder is slightly different as I think it also has cream of tartar.

Timeforabiscuit · 11/11/2018 10:07

Baking powder is already acified, bicarbonate isnt - so get the bicarb and add a little lemon juice or cream of tartar tothe the same effect.

Usually in cleaning i use straight bicarbonate though.
